About SuperAwesome
SuperAwesome is more than a single game mode. It is a Danish Minecraft network where players can create their own servers, play on other people's servers, and move between them through the Limbo hub.
Creators can start a server for free, choose its style, change settings, and add plugins or scripts. Players may find Prison, Skyblock, Factions, KitPvP, minigames, creative builds, and many smaller community projects in the same network.
What Makes It Different
Most Minecraft networks give you a menu of fixed modes. SuperAwesome also lets players become server owners. You can create a server, shape it with plugins, and invite people into your own idea.
Prison servers turn mining into a gated progression ladder: players break blocks in designated mines, sell the resources, and spend their earnings on ranks that unlock more valuable areas.
Prison is one of the most visible and repeatedly associated hosted server styles.
Minigames are compact Minecraft games with their own rules, objective, and bounded play area, usually resolved in a single round.
The network supports multiple small competitive and casual game projects.
Join the main network and use Limbo to reach the available servers and lobbies. You can also connect to a hosted server through its own subdomain when one is available.
Players who want to build a server can use `/sm createserver <name>`. The `/sm help` command lists the available network commands. Linking Discord with `/sadiscordlink` unlocks access to the owner dashboard.
Progression is different on every hosted server. A Prison server may use ranks and mines, while a KitPvP server may focus on kits, kills, and upgrades.
The network also has server points, player points, ems, and LabyCoins. VIP and PRO plans improve owner-side progression by increasing hosting limits and point-earning options.
Server owners can add plugins and Skript files through SFTP. Server Manager also supports custom MOTDs, icons, whitelists, PvP settings, difficulty, player limits, and server flavours such as Survival, SMP, KitPvP, PvP, or Economy.
The network is organized around Limbo and separate player-created servers rather than one shared survival map. Each hosted server can have its own world, settings, plugins, rules, and style.
PvP is controlled server by server. Owners can enable or disable it through Server Manager, so combat rules depend on the world you join. PvP-focused hosted servers include KitPvP projects and other competitive modes.
SuperAwesome uses network currencies such as ems, also called Emeralder or emeralds, plus LabyCoins and server points. Ems can be used with network tools such as SAStore. Individual hosted servers may add their own currencies, shops, ranks, or reward systems.
Events depend on the hosted servers. SuperAwesome has an event destination in the network, while individual communities can run their own competitions, giveaways, and scheduled activities.
SuperAwesome is Danish-first and has a dedicated Discord community for players, server owners, and technical support. The social side is built around discovering other servers, sharing projects, and helping owners solve setup problems.
Joining the network and creating a basic server are free. SuperAwesome sells VIP and PRO upgrades, server advertising, and lobby kits. VIP increases hosting access and player limits, while PRO adds larger resources, backups, MySQL access, advertising exposure, and possible external hosting. Hosted servers may operate separate stores of their own.

History of SuperAwesome
SuperAwesome was already running by May 18, 2016 under the superawesome.dk address. Its early identity centered on a broad Minecraft network rather than one fixed game mode, with several familiar modes available to players.
A dedicated Discord community was established on August 1, 2020. The network's identity grew around two groups at once: players looking for places to play and owners looking for a simple way to launch their own servers.
Over time, SuperAwesome developed into a player-server platform. Free server creation was joined by plugin support, SFTP access, configurable server settings, advertising tools, network points, and server-specific shops. This made each hosted server more flexible than a normal preset game-mode portal.
The network later added a web-based Server Manager for changing MOTDs, icons, whitelists, PvP, difficulty, player limits, and server style. VIP and PRO plans expanded hosting resources, backups, player limits, and owner tools.
In 2025 and 2026, the network continued building out guides for server creation, plugin installation, external hosting, Discord linking, advertising, and custom shop systems. Today, SuperAwesome is a Danish hub for free player-run Minecraft servers, with Limbo acting as the main gateway between community worlds.
